Course Overview

This four-year Modern Languages BA Honours degree immerses you in the study of foreign culture and society. Focusing on the development of your language skills in your chosen languages, you'll graduate with an appreciation for other cultures and multilingual skills sought by employers. You can choose to study up to three languages from a choice of: Chinese French German Japanese Portuguese Spanish Through our multidisciplinary approach to teaching, you'll gain an in-depth insight into how culture, cinema, history, politics, and society shape the countries where your chosen languages are spoken. You will have the knowledge and understanding you need to engage with people in their native language. You'll become a confident multilinguist, ready to embark on your career journey as a global citizen.

Language Requirement

  • Applicants whose first language is not English require a minimum score of IELTS 6.5 or equivalent with no less than 5.5 in each of the four elements of the test.
